We tried to schedule an Adventure Sea Caves Kayak tour just a few days before the date of the trip on a holiday weekend. Tickets for the ferry were totally sold out even though tickets for the kayak tour were available. I called and left a VM to see if we could be put on a waitlist or something. Leslie called me, got us on the waitlist, and just a couple days later told us we were in!

Directions are very easy to follow. Once you’re on-island, the guides are also fantastic. Felt totally safe and prepared. They provided wetsuits, splash jackets, PFDs, and helmets. I HIGHLY recommend bringing water shoes of some kind ($20 from target) to make life a little easier and a hat for between your head and the helmet.

We tipped out of our kayak at the “boat wrecker” cave and Chuck didn’t even blink. Easily helped us back in and away we went. It was our favorite part of the trip!

They have places to store your things safely while you’re gone and changing rooms to get back into your dry clothes. If you do the longer trip starting at 1030 AM, note that you’ll probably only have time for the one quick hike (we packed a lunch and ate on the go).

We felt it was 100% worth the cost and time. Amazing memories! Would absolutely do it again and highly recommend.

Been to Santa Cruz Island few times before for hiking, enjoying the views. This time decided to try kayaking since I had never done it before. Booking on website was fairly straightforward. We did the Discovery Tour. They provided A LOT of info, however, some of it may be outdated. Their video said they may provide water shoes, but then when I called the guy said they stopped doing that, so I went out and bought a pair. But then on the island they said they had some if you didn't have any. Their facility on the island provides a small store, but I didn't bother to check out what they offered. I think they said you could get some small snacks, waterproof bags for your phone, or lanyards for your glasses. They also have a changing area and storage bins for your belongings. They provide everything, including life vest, helmet, slicker jacket, wetsuit (optional), the paddle, and the kayak. The trek from this little facility to the beach was about 1/2 mile. The staff/guides were all very polite, helpful, and knowledgeable. They try to keep the groups small. Ours consisted of 6 people on 3 kayaks. Our guide, Cassie, was excellent and very skilled. She gave us very good instruction, and provided info about flora, fauna, geography, geology, biology throughout the excursion. We paddled through several caves and saw sea lions, baby sea lions, and Pigeon Guillemot. We were good and worn out by the end, which I believe was about 90 minutes on the water. We had a really fun time and got a great workout, too. One couple got a little too tired but Cassie was strong and able to help tow them in with no issue. I'm only dropping 1 star for the info on the website being a bit outdated and the 1/2 mile trek to the beach. Outside of that, I would absolutely recommend this.
